sleep():
It is a static method on Thread class. It makes the current thread into the
"Not Runnable" state for specified amount of time. During this time, the thread
keeps the lock (monitors) it has acquired.
wait():
It is a method on Object class. It makes the current thread into the "Not Runnable"
state. Wait is called on a object, not a thread. Before calling wait() method, the
object should be synchronized, means the object should be inside synchronized block.
The call to wait() releases the acquired lock.
